Title: The Innovative Contributions of Jerzy Winiarski
Introduction
Jerzy Winiarski is a prominent inventor based in Warsaw, Poland, known for his notable contributions to the field of pharmaceuticals. With a total of four patents to his name, he has made significant strides in the preparation of vitamin K derivatives, showcasing his ingenuity and expertise in chemical processes.
Latest Patents
Winiarski’s latest inventions reflect his dedication to advancing the pharmaceutical industry. One of his notable patents is a process for the preparation of vitamin K2 derivatives, which introduces an improved methodology represented by a specific formula where n ranges from 3 to 13. Another significant patent involves a process for preparing the MK-7 type of vitamin K2. This process cleverly utilizes a hexaprenyl chain of 'all-trans' configuration attached to a monoprenyl derivative of menadiol, following a '1+6' synthetic strategy. This method innovatively generates α-sulfonyl carbanions in situ and employs specific halides, which enhances the alkylation reaction to yield high-purity products.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Jerzy Winiarski has secured valuable experiences working with esteemed institutions such as the Pharmaceutical Institute and the Łukasiewicz Research Network – Institute of Industrial Chemistry. His work here has allowed him to refine his research skills and focus on impactful innovations in the realm of pharmaceuticals.
Collaborations
Collaboration has been a key aspect of Winiarski's journey. He has worked alongside accomplished colleagues such as Andrzej Kutner and Wiesław Szelejewski, sharing insights and fostering an environment of creative problem-solving that enhances the development of new therapeutic products.
